CX56 CKK is a 2006 Kawasaki Zr 1000 A6F in Blue with a 953c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 82.4%.
Across all 2006 Kawasaki Zr 1000 A6F models, the average MOT pass rate is 85.7% with a typical mileage of 14,508 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Kawasaki Zr 1000 A6F f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 37 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CX56 CKK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kawasaki Zr 1000 A6F typ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 20 years old, this Kawasaki Zr 1000 A6F is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
